Description
In dem Hauptpatent ist ein Verfahren zum selbsttätigen Anlassen von Dampfturbinen in Vorschlag gebracht, bei welchem die einzelnen Abschnitte des Anlaßvorganges in Abhängigkeit von Meßgrößen selbsttätig gesteuert werden, welche die jederzeitige Beanspruchung der Turbine während des Anlaufens kennzeichnen. Als solche Meßgröße ist in dem Patent u. a. der Förderdruck der ölpumpe angegeben.In the main patent is a method for automatic starting of steam turbines Brought into proposal, in which the individual sections of the starting process as a function are automatically controlled by measured variables, which the constant stress mark the turbine during start-up. As such a measurable variable, the patent inter alia. the delivery pressure of the oil pump specified.
Gemäß der Erfindung wird diese Meßgröße dazu benutzt, einen bestimmten Teil des gesamten Anlaßverfahrens zu übernehmen, nämlich den zum Absaugen des Stopfbüchsendampfes vorgesehenen Strahlsauger einzuschalten. Die Einschaltung des Strahlsaugers erfolgt mittels eines in der Dampf- oder Wasserzuleitung des Saugers vorgesehenen Ventils, welches in Abhängigkeit vom Druck der Ölversorgung geöffnet wird. Durch diese Einrichtung ist dafür gesorgt, daß der Strahlsauger zur Absaugung des in den Stopfbüchsen anfallenden Dampfes unabhängig von der Aufmerksamkeit des Überwachungspersonals rechtzeitig eingeschaltet wird.According to the invention, this measured variable is used to determine a certain part of the total To take over the starting process, namely to switch on the jet suction device provided for sucking off the stuffing box steam. The jet suction device is switched on by means of a device provided in the steam or water supply line of the suction device Valve, which is opened depending on the pressure of the oil supply. Through this Facility is ensured that the jet suction device for sucking off the stuffing boxes generated steam regardless of the attention of the monitoring staff is switched on in time.
Ein Ausführungsbeispiel der Erfindung ist in der Zeichnung im Schema dargestellt.An embodiment of the invention is shown in the drawing in the scheme.
ι ist die Turbine, welche den Stromerzeuger 2 antreibt. 3 und 4 sind die Stopfbüchsen, die durch Rohrleitungen S und 6 an den Strahlsauger 7 angeschlossen sind. Der Strahlsauger wird mit Frischdampf betrieben, welcher durch die Leitung 8 zugeführt wird. In dieser Leitung ist ein Ventil 9 vorgesehen, welches mittels eines kleinen Kraftgetriebes 10 verstellt wird. Das Ventil wird durch eine Feder dieses Getriebes geschlossen gehalten. Unterhalb des Kraftkolbens ist eine Leitung 11 eingeführt, welche mit der Druckleitung der Ölversorgung in Verbindung steht.ι is the turbine that drives the generator 2. 3 and 4 are the stuffing boxes, which are connected to the ejector 7 by pipes S and 6. The ejector is operated with live steam, which is supplied through line 8. A valve 9 is provided in this line, which is adjusted by means of a small power transmission 10. The valve is through a spring of this transmission kept closed. Below the power piston is a Line 11 introduced, which with the pressure line the oil supply is connected.
Nimmt der Öldruck beim Anlassen der Turbine einen bestimmten Wert an, so wird die Federkraft überwunden und der Kraftkolben nach oben bewegt, wodurch das Ventil geöffnet wird. Die Zufuhr des Frischdampfes zum Strahlsauger 7 wird damit freigegeben, so daß der in den Stopfbüchsen 3 und 4 anfallende Dampf abgesaugt wird. Bei Sinken des Öldruckes durch Abstellen der Turbine wird das Absperrventil 9 wieder geschlossen und somit der Strahlsauger selbsttätig wieder abgeschaltet.If the oil pressure assumes a certain value when the turbine is started, then the spring force is overcome and the power piston moves upwards, causing the valve is opened. The supply of the live steam to the ejector 7 is thus released, so that the steam accumulating in the stuffing boxes 3 and 4 is sucked off. When sinking the oil pressure by turning off the turbine, the shut-off valve 9 is closed again and thus the ejector automatically switched off again.
